About the role
Due to continued growth, we are looking for additional team members. As a Butchery Operative, you will be part of a warm and friendly team working in a fast-paced environment. You will be responsible for ensuring all products in the Butchery Department are packaged whilst meeting high standards and quality ready for delivery. You will possess a can-do attitude, be an effective team player, have great attention to detail, and be able to work in an organised, methodical and professional manner.
Responsibilities will include:
- Metal detecting
- Boxing and labelling
- Collating of orders ready for delivery
- Cleaning
- Bagging of burgers, vacuum packing and making up boxes with orders
- Completion of paperwork around collation area
- Inputting weights into the computer and updating spreadsheets
